在数字化时代,后端集成框架成为了构建高效系统的关键。对于想要进入IT行业或提升自己技能的年轻人来说,掌握这些框架是通往企业级应用开发的重要一步。本文将从零基础出发,详细介绍后端集成框架的概念、常用框架、搭建步骤以及实战技巧,帮助读者解锁企业级应用开发的密码。
一、什么是后端集成框架?
后端集成框架是一种软件架构模式,它将应用程序的各个组件(如数据库、服务、缓存等)集成在一起,为开发者提供一套标准化的开发接口和工具。通过使用这些框架,开发者可以快速搭建系统,提高开发效率,降低维护成本。
二、常用后端集成框架
目前,市面上有很多优秀的后端集成框架,以下是一些常用的:
- Spring Boot:Java领域的明星框架,简化了Spring应用的初始搭建以及开发过程。
- Django:Python领域的首选框架,以“快速、简洁、优雅”著称。
- Express.js:Node.js的轻量级框架,适用于构建快速、可扩展的Web应用。
- Flask:Python的一个轻量级Web应用框架,适合快速开发原型。
- Ruby on Rails:Ruby语言的框架,以“约定优于配置”的理念著称。
三、搭建高效系统的步骤
- 需求分析:明确系统的功能、性能、安全性等要求。
- 技术选型:根据需求选择合适的后端集成框架。
- 环境搭建:配置开发环境,包括数据库、服务器等。
- 代码编写:根据框架规范,编写业务逻辑代码。
- 测试与优化:对系统进行功能测试、性能测试,并进行优化。
- 部署上线:将系统部署到服务器,进行实际运行。
四、实战技巧
- 模块化设计:将系统划分为多个模块,提高代码可读性和可维护性。
- 代码复用:通过编写可复用的组件和库,提高开发效率。
- 接口设计:遵循RESTful API设计原则,确保接口的简洁和易用。
- 安全性考虑:关注数据安全、权限控制等方面,防止系统被攻击。
- 性能优化:通过缓存、数据库优化等手段,提高系统性能。
五、总结
掌握后端集成框架,可以帮助我们轻松搭建高效系统。通过本文的介绍,相信你已经对后端集成框架有了初步的了解。在实际开发过程中,不断学习、实践和总结,才能解锁企业级应用开发的密码。祝你学习顺利,早日成为一名优秀的后端开发工程师!
